Description
Discover the full-bodied resonance and commanding presence of the Eastman Guitars AC330E Jumbo Acoustic-electric Guitar. Designed for musicians who demand both acoustic warmth and electric versatility, this guitar is a testament to Eastman's dedication to quality craftsmanship. The solid wood construction features a Sitka spruce top paired with mahogany back and sides, delivering a rich, balanced tone that projects beautifully in any setting. The jumbo body ensures a deep, resonant sound that fills the room, making it ideal for both solo performances and ensemble play.
The AC330E's Traditional Even C mahogany neck offers a comfortable grip, while the ebony fingerboard provides smooth playability. Whether you're strumming chords or picking melodies, this guitar promises a seamless playing experience. Hand-scalloped X-bracing enhances the guitar's resonance, maintaining the integrity and strength of the spruce top.
For those ready to plug in, the LR Baggs Element VTC electronics system delivers studio-quality sound with an all-discrete Class A preamp and a specialized LF compressor. This ensures your amplified sound retains the natural warmth and clarity of your acoustic tone, making it perfect for stage performances and recordings alike.
Key Features:
- Jumbo body for superior projection and full-bodied tone
- Solid Sitka spruce top and mahogany back and sides
- Mahogany neck with Traditional Even C shape
- Ebony fingerboard with Jescar frets
- Hand-scalloped X-bracing for enhanced resonance
- LR Baggs Element VTC under-saddle pickup with volume, tone, and compression controls
- Bone nut and nickel hardware
